news 2026/4/18 12:58:45

MetaTube插件FC2影片刮削故障终极解决方案与深度优化指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
MetaTube插件FC2影片刮削故障终极解决方案与深度优化指南

MetaTube插件FC2影片刮削故障终极解决方案与深度优化指南

【免费下载链接】jellyfin-plugin-metatubeMetaTube Plugin for Jellyfin/Emby项目地址: https://gitcode.com/gh_mirrors/je/jellyfin-plugin-metatube

作为Jellyfin生态中备受青睐的元数据刮削插件,MetaTube在处理FC2系列影片时遭遇了前所未有的刮削障碍。本文将通过真实用户案例,系统性地剖析问题根源,并提供分层解决方案,助你打造更加智能高效的影音库管理系统。🚀

📊 真实场景:用户痛点全解析

当我们收到用户反馈"FC2-4530010影片无法识别"时,我们发现这不仅仅是单一的技术故障,而是整个插件生态面临的系统性挑战。

典型故障现象

  • 搜索无响应:输入FC2编号后插件返回空白结果
  • 元数据缺失:影片封面、演员信息、剧情简介等关键数据完全空白
  • 系统日志异常:频繁出现API连接超时和域名解析失败记录
  • 插件状态异常:管理界面显示FC2提供商处于离线状态

🔍 根因分析:从表象到本质

通过深入分析插件架构,我们发现问题的核心在于服务端点的硬编码配置。当FC2服务从fc2hub.com迁移至javten.com时,原有的API端点配置完全失效。

技术诊断矩阵

  • API端点失效:硬编码的服务地址无法适应服务迁移
  • 请求适配失败:新服务的接口规范与原有逻辑不兼容
  • 错误处理机制缺失:缺乏有效的故障转移和回退策略

🛠️ 分层解决方案:从紧急修复到架构优化

第一层:紧急修复策略

针对API端点失效问题,我们采用"端点替换法"快速恢复服务:

// 旧配置 private const string BaseUrl = "https://fc2hub.com/api"; // 新配置 private const string BaseUrl = "https://javten.com/api";

3分钟快速诊断

  1. 检查Jellyfin.Plugin.MetaTube/Providers/目录下的相关实现文件
  2. 确认API基础URL配置
  3. 验证网络连通性

第二层:配置化改造

为了避免类似问题再次发生,我们将硬编码参数转为配置文件管理:

<MetaTubeConfig> <FC2Provider> <BaseUrl>https://javten.com/api</BaseUrl> <Timeout>30</Timeout> <RetryCount>3</RetryCount> </FC2Provider> </MetaTubeConfig>

第三层:架构升级

实现智能化的多级回退机制:

  • 主服务失效时自动切换到备用端点
  • 本地缓存减少对外部API的依赖
  • 优雅降级确保基本功能可用

📈 性能优化前后对比

优化项目优化前优化后提升幅度
API响应时间5-8秒1-2秒75%
刮削成功率65%95%30%
并发处理能力10个请求50个请求400%

🎯 一键配置模板

我们为常见场景准备了现成的配置模板,用户只需简单修改即可使用:

{ "providers": { "fc2": { "enabled": true, "baseUrl": "https://javten.com/api", "fallbackUrls": [ "https://fc2hub.com/api", "https://backup.javten.com/api" ] }

🔧 插件健康度自检清单

连通性检查

  • API端点可达性验证
  • 网络连接状态检测
  • 服务认证状态确认

性能监控

  • 响应时间统计
  • 成功率指标追踪
  • 并发处理能力评估

💡 实战演练:step-by-step操作指南

第一步:定位问题文件

# 查找FC2相关实现 find . -name "*.cs" -exec grep -l "FC2" {} \;

第二步:更新端点配置在相关Provider文件中,替换硬编码的API地址为新服务域名。

第三步:验证修复效果重启Jellyfin服务,测试FC2影片的刮削功能。

🚀 未来展望:智能刮削新趋势

随着AI技术的快速发展,元数据刮削正在迎来革命性变革:

智能内容识别:基于影片画面自动生成标签和分类个性化推荐:根据用户观影习惯智能匹配相关内容多源数据融合:整合多个数据源提供更全面的元数据信息

📝 常见问题速查表

Q: FC2影片刮削完全失效怎么办?A: 检查API端点配置,确认服务域名已更新为javten.com

Q: 插件配置修改后需要重启吗?A: 是的,任何配置变更都需要重启Jellyfin服务才能生效

🌟 总结与行动建议

通过本次FC2元数据刮削故障的系统性修复,我们不仅解决了眼前的技术问题,更重要的是建立了一套完整的插件运维体系。记住,优秀的插件管理需要持续的关注和优化——定期检查服务状态、及时更新配置参数、建立完善的监控机制。

立即行动起来,让你的Jellyfin影音库焕发新的生机!现在就开始优化你的MetaTube插件配置,享受更智能、更高效的元数据管理体验。

【免费下载链接】jellyfin-plugin-metatubeMetaTube Plugin for Jellyfin/Emby项目地址: https://gitcode.com/gh_mirrors/je/jellyfin-plugin-metatube

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 6:31:41

告别Steam限制!WorkshopDL模组下载工具完全使用手册

告别Steam限制&#xff01;WorkshopDL模组下载工具完全使用手册 【免费下载链接】WorkshopDL WorkshopDL - The Best Steam Workshop Downloader 项目地址: https://gitcode.com/gh_mirrors/wo/WorkshopDL 还在为无法访问Steam创意工坊而发愁吗&#xff1f;让我告诉你一…

作者头像 李华
网站建设 2026/4/18 6:31:41

Whisper Large v3插件开发:常用IDE扩展

Whisper Large v3插件开发&#xff1a;常用IDE扩展 1. 章节名称 1.1 子主题名称 列表项一列表项二 print("示例代码")获取更多AI镜像 想探索更多AI镜像和应用场景&#xff1f;访问 CSDN星图镜像广场&#xff0c;提供丰富的预置镜像&#xff0c;覆盖大模型推理、图…

作者头像 李华
网站建设 2026/4/18 6:30:35

BAAI/bge-m3保姆级教程:手把手教你做多语言文本匹配

BAAI/bge-m3保姆级教程&#xff1a;手把手教你做多语言文本匹配 1. 引言&#xff1a;为什么需要bge-m3&#xff1f; 在构建跨语言信息检索系统、AI知识库或RAG&#xff08;检索增强生成&#xff09;应用时&#xff0c;语义相似度计算是决定系统效果的核心环节。传统关键词匹配…

作者头像 李华
网站建设 2026/4/18 6:26:01

FigmaCN中文界面本地化技术实现深度解析

FigmaCN中文界面本地化技术实现深度解析 【免费下载链接】figmaCN 中文 Figma 插件&#xff0c;设计师人工翻译校验 项目地址: https://gitcode.com/gh_mirrors/fi/figmaCN FigmaCN作为专业的界面本地化解决方案&#xff0c;通过系统化的技术架构实现了Figma界面的精准中…

作者头像 李华
网站建设 2026/4/18 8:47:11

Switch注入终极指南:TegraRcmGUI图形化工具完全掌握手册

Switch注入终极指南&#xff1a;TegraRcmGUI图形化工具完全掌握手册 【免费下载链接】TegraRcmGUI C GUI for TegraRcmSmash (Fuse Gele exploit for Nintendo Switch) 项目地址: https://gitcode.com/gh_mirrors/te/TegraRcmGUI 还在为复杂的命令行操作而头疼吗&#x…

作者头像 李华
网站建设 2026/4/18 8:01:03

Qwen3-Embedding-4B部署踩坑记:常见问题解决方案汇总

Qwen3-Embedding-4B部署踩坑记&#xff1a;常见问题解决方案汇总 1. 背景与应用场景 随着大模型在检索增强生成&#xff08;RAG&#xff09;、语义搜索、多语言文本理解等场景中的广泛应用&#xff0c;高质量的文本嵌入模型成为系统性能的关键瓶颈。Qwen3-Embedding-4B作为通…

作者头像 李华